(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程

Ubuntu安装详细教程(从下载镜像到安装NVIDIA驱动)

  • 1、下载镜像文件
  • 2、制作硬盘镜像
    • 2.1 安装UltraISO并打开ISO文件
    • 2.2 制作硬盘镜像
    • 2.3 检查是否成功
  • 3、划分磁盘
    • 3.1 首先右键“开始”图标选择“磁盘管理”
    • 3.2 划分(压缩)
  • 4、安装Ubuntu系统
    • 4.1 进入启动管理
    • 4.2 check
    • 4.3 安装Ubuntu
    • 4.4 tips
    • 4.5 键盘布局
    • 4.6 WIFI连接
    • 4.7 配置
    • 4.8 安装类型
    • 4.9 选区(十分重要,谨慎操作!)
    • 4.10 地区
    • 4.11 最后
  • 5、安装NVIDIA驱动
    • 5.1 方式一:安装Ubuntu提供的nvidia驱动
    • 5.2 方式二:手动安装
  • 6、一些其他实用配置

环境配置系列:

(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程
(二)Ubuntu系统Pytorch环境配置
(三)Windows系统Pytorch环境配置(简易方法安装CUDA和cuDNN)

Ubuntu20.04+GTX 1050(notebook)安装paddlepaddle

1、下载镜像文件

在清华大学开源软件镜像站 | Tsinghua Open Source Mirror搜索ubuntu,进入ubuntu-releases选择版本,这里选择20.04里的ubuntu-20.04.4-desktop-amd64.iso为例,下载保存
(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第1张图片

2、制作硬盘镜像

首先你需要准备一个至少8G的U盘(会被格式化,请备份好资料)

2.1 安装UltraISO并打开ISO文件

  1. 下载UltraISO软件并且安装
  2. 打开UltraISO软件,点击“继续试用”
  3. 加载ISO镜像文件:“文件”-“打开”-选中上面下载的"ubuntu-20.04.4-desktop-amd64.iso"文件,成功后如下图
    (一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第2张图片

2.2 制作硬盘镜像

启动”-“写入硬盘映像…”-选中你的U盘-点击“写入”-在弹出的“确定继续操作码?”选择“是”-等待写入完成
(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第3张图片

2.3 检查是否成功

从下图以及U盘名字及内容可以看出成功了(U盘名字及内容不一定和我的完全一致,只要“刻录成功!”一般都没问题)
(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第4张图片
(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第5张图片

3、划分磁盘

3.1 首先右键“开始”图标选择“磁盘管理”

可以看到我有C和D两个盘,还有3个特殊作用的区(系统分区和恢复分区),特殊作用的区不可动。磁盘划分是为了给Ubuntu系统划一块“地”,因为我的D盘空间很多,所以准备从D盘划一块出来(如果你其他盘空间够多,也可以从其他盘去划分)。
在这里插入图片描述

3.2 划分(压缩)

右键D盘,选择“压缩卷”,从下图可以看出我“可用压缩空间大小”为56G左右,这里我准备划分40G给Ubuntu(实际上划分多少根据自己需求来定,我实际上是划分了60G,有时候还是捉襟见肘,建议可以100G)。输入要压缩的空间量后,点击“压缩”。
(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第6张图片
这是压缩划分后的结果,可以看到大概有39G准备给Ubuntu用:
在这里插入图片描述

4、安装Ubuntu系统

4.1 进入启动管理

首先你需要知道你的电脑如何设置从U盘启动,不同设备方法不太一样,建议百度或者咨询厂家客服。

下图是我的设备进入启动管理的界面,红色就是我的写入了Ubuntu镜像的U盘,绿色的就是我的windows系统盘,蓝色就是我之前安装好的Ubuntu系统盘。(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第7张图片

4.2 check

在这里我们选择U盘进入,进入后,会进行check过程,等待它完成。
(有可能这里有不一样的,无论怎样,选择“安装Ubuntu”或者"Install Ubuntu")
(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第8张图片

4.3 安装Ubuntu

你可能会进入到下面这个界面,按红色标记选择即可
(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第9张图片
也或许是纯黑色界面,其中给了你几个选择,选择“install ubuntu”即可

4.4 tips

接下来是一些安装过程中的步骤,常见的步骤都能理解,所以会有一些步骤下面不会提及

4.5 键盘布局

不用说了,看图

4.6 WIFI连接

看你自己

4.7 配置

4.8 安装类型

双系统就选“其他选项”

4.9 选区(十分重要,谨慎操作!)

谨慎选择,因为会格式化选中的区,选错了就gg了。

首先我们要找到上面我们划分的区。

  • 寻区
    我在前面是预留了近39GB的空间,并且是“未分配”状态。从下图看到选中的区是“free space(空闲)”,并且容量为41GB(因为换算方式差异,所以实际上就是上面39GB的区),且“used(已使用)”为空,所以它就是我们上面划分出来的区。(tips:实际上该区41GB最接近39GB大小,显示的其他区大小和39GB根本不沾边)
  • 新建区
    所以选中这个区,然后点击“+”,其他的不用修改,只需要把“Mount point(挂载点)”修改为“/”即可,然后“OK”
    (一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第10张图片
  • 安装到该区
    下面是成功后,此时我们的41GB区变成了“有名字”且“Used”有字符的区(device)
    现在我们在“Device for boot loader installation”选择该区(从名字选择,都是“xxxp8”),然后“Install Now”,(后面会有提示框,如果确定你的区选择没错后,直接点击继续即可)

4.10 地区

4.11 最后

后面应该就正常安装成功,重启后,依然要进入“启动管理”,在这里应该就能看到你的Ubuntu系统了(蓝色框)(U盘拔了是没有第一个的),直接确认进去即可,以后都是从这里进入选择你的双系统。
(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第11张图片

5、安装NVIDIA驱动

安装nvidia驱动有两种方式,1)从Ubuntu设置中去安装;2)自己下载nvidia驱动安装。

  • 方式一:不能选择任意的版本,但是对于有多屏等使用十分友好,实际如果要使用CUDA也可以使用该方法安装(没必要安装最新驱动,实际上该方法提供的驱动已经能满足使用CUDA的需求了)。
  • 方法二:自己去官网下载你显卡的任意版本驱动,安装后可能会遇到X server或nouveau 等一些了相关问题,需要好好折腾一番。(至少我遇到了无法分屏的问题,最终也没解决,使用方法一安装驱动后完美解决)

5.1 方式一:安装Ubuntu提供的nvidia驱动

打开“设置”-“关于”-“附加驱动”-选择“(专有)”的NVIDIA驱动,我选择了一个最新的(实际上从官网下载的也是51x,证明版本没有落后),“应用更改”后等待即可,安装好了重启一下。
(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第12张图片

重启后进入系统打开终端,输入“nvidia-smi”,显示类似这种就证明驱动安装成功了
(一)Ubuntu安装详细教程(从镜像制作到NVIDIA驱动安装全流程)——超详细的图文教程_第13张图片
注意:某些主板因安全问题,安装windows以外的系统后启动可能会报错:Verification failed :0X1A security violation,此时需要进入主板BIOS进行设置,常规主板百度这个报错信息就会有教程设置,对于某些华硕主板设置方式略有不同,按下图设置

5.2 方式二:手动安装

可以参考Ubuntu20+GTX3080的Pytorch环境搭建,但是这个教程不是桌面Ubuntu系统,也就是该教程是在纯命令行的Ubuntu下实践成功的。但是其中关于解决nouveau问题的方法在桌面级Ubuntu下亲测可用。

如果以后有机会再详写手动安装的方法。

6、一些其他实用配置

Ubuntu软件系列—添加实时网速

你可能感兴趣的:(环境搭建,ubuntu,linux,运维)